However, studying the Archaeology (Hons) from University of York doesn't mean you have to become an archaeologist. Our degrees prepare you for a vast range of careers; the unique combination of humanities and sciences at York means you'll be competent in dealing with data as well as able to produce high-quality essays and reports.
Quick Facts:
- Advances in science mean we can discover more about the history of humankind than ever before.â
- You can follow your interests in any time period, from the Palaeolithic to the 21st century. You'll develop your skills in a broad range of archaeological methods across the arts and sciences, through a combination of hands-on learning and small group teaching.
- The department is renowned for being friendly and welcoming, meaning you'll get to know your lecturers, and they'll get to know you. You'll have endless opportunities to get involved, from joining the Archaeology Society to working abroad on a research project. We're based in the King's Manor in the city centre - a beautiful and truly unique Medieval building, with additional state-of-the-art facilities on the main campus.
- York is the UK’s archaeological capital, with historic buildings and significant remains from the Roman, Viking and Medieval periods. You'll find it a great place to call home.
- There has never been a better time to study archaeology. With major new infrastructure projects such as HS2 and Crossrail underway, there is a national shortage of archaeologists in the country.
- If you're interested in going into the heritage sector, you'll be able to choose modules which provide you with a solid grounding in heritage studies alongside the practical skills needed to kick-start your career. York is a real centre for the heritage industry, and you'll have the opportunity to forge links with museums and heritage organisations through optional volunteering, internships and placements.
The graduates have gone on to work in:
- heritage organisations (eg English Heritage, National Trust, Yorkshire Museum)
- local councils
- NHS
- police
- accountancy
- media
- marketing agencies
- law

General requirements
A levels
- ABB/BBB
Access to Higher Education Diploma
- 30 credits at Distinction and 15 credits at Merit or higher
BTEC National Extended Diploma
- DDM
Cambridge Pre-U
- D3, M2, M2
European Baccalaureate
- 75% or higher
International Baccalaureate
- 34 points
